随着区块链技术的快速发展,越来越多的金融机构开始采用这一新兴技术来提高业务效率、降低交易成本以及确保数据的安全性。然而,区块链技术虽然在安全性上表现出了许多优势,但在其应用过程中仍然面临着诸多安全问题。本文将深入探讨区块链金融机构所面临的安全问题及相应的应对策略,并解答一些相关的重要问题。
区块链技术的核心理念是去中心化,数据在分布式网络中通过加密算法进行维护和验证。虽然这一机制为金融机构提供了一定的安全保障,但在实际应用中,仍然存在众多安全隐患。
首先,区块链网络的共识机制并非绝对安全,尤其是在参与节点数量不足的情况下,可能出现51%攻击等安全风险。攻击者如果获得网络中超过一半的算力,就可以对区块链数据进行篡改,造成严重后果。
其次,智能合约的安全性同样令人担忧。智能合约是运行在区块链上的自动化合约,虽然其程序代码通常是公开透明的,但如果未经过充分的测试与审查,或包含逻辑错误,可能被黑客利用,导致资金损失。
再者,区块链技术虽然在数据传输和存储方面具备较强的隐私保护能力,但在用户身份验证与管理方面,仍需采用传统的KYC(了解你的客户)与AML(反洗钱)政策,可能导致用户数据泄露,引发安全事件。
区块链金融机构面临的安全问题主要体现在以下几个方面:
区块链网络的分布特性虽然增强了其抗攻击能力,但网络攻击仍然是一大隐患。除了51%攻击外,DDoS(分布式拒绝服务攻击)也是一种常见的威胁。攻击者可以通过向网络发送大量垃圾数据,导致网络拥堵,影响其正常运行。
智能合约是区块链金融机构常用的一种应用,但如果开发过程中出现漏洞,会导致严重的安全问题。例如,2016年以太坊的DAO(去中心化自治组织)事件,由于智能合约代码中的漏洞,导致价值5000万美元的以太币被盗。此事件警示了智能合约开发中需借助专业审计工具和团队对代码进行严格审核。
区块链技术常常依赖私钥进行身份验证,用户的私钥安全性直接关系到资产的安全。如果用户私钥被黑客窃取,资金将面临被盗风险。另外,如果用户管理不善,导致丢失私钥,也会造成不可逆转的资产损失。
金融行业是一个高度监管的市场,区块链技术的快速落地,使得金融机构在合规方面面临诸多挑战。如何在利用区块链技术提升效率的同时,遵循各国的法律法规,避免因合规问题带来的罚款或法律责任,成为金融机构亟待解决的安全问题。
虽然区块链技术本身具有一定的数据隐私保护能力,但在涉及用户身份和交易信息时,如何平衡透明性与隐私保护仍然是一个难题。用户的敏感信息在链上存储时,如果不加密,可能被恶意用户访问,造成隐私泄露。
为了应对上述安全问题,区块链金融机构可采取以下几种策略:
金融机构应强化网络安全基础设施,采用多层次的安全防护机制,抵御DDoS等攻击。同时,定期对网络进行安全检测与风险评估,及时识别潜在威胁,并做好应急响应措施,确保网络稳定运行。
金融机构在使用智能合约时,应寻求专业的第三方机构对合约代码进行全面审计,确保代码逻辑正确、无漏洞。此外,增加智能合约的可升级性,以便在发现问题后能及时修复和更新合约。
建立健全的身份管理和验证体系,采用多重身份验证(如生物识别、双因素认证等),提高账户安全性。同时,金融机构应加强客户教育,提高用户对私钥安全性和使用的认识。
金融机构应始终关注各国的法律法规变化,组建合规团队,确保在业务开展时遵循相关法律法规,避免因疏忽产生不必要的法律风险。
在区块链技术应用中,要对用户敏感数据进行加密,确保数据在存储和传输过程中不被窃取。同时,采用细粒度的访问控制策略,确保只有授权用户才能访问的重要数据,增强数据隐私保护能力。
区块链技术在金融领域中具有诸多优势。其中最显著的是去中心化的特性,使得交易不再依赖于中心化的金融机构,从而降低成本和提高效率。此外,区块链的数据透明性和不可篡改性,也使得交易记录可以被多方验证,减少金融欺诈的发生。此外,区块链技术还可以实现智能合约,自动化执行合同条款,这在众多金融业务中具有广泛的应用前景。
区块链安全审计是一项重要的保障措施,旨在确保区块链系统及其组成部分的安全性及可靠性。通过系统的安全审计,可以发现智能合约中的漏洞、网络结构的弱点以及潜在的安全风险,从而通过整改和来提高系统的整体安全水平。在以往的金融欺诈事件中,未能进行有效的安全审计往往是造成重大损失的原因。
区块链技术通过其去中心化、透明性和高效性,可以有效解决传统金融中存在的许多痛点。例如,在跨境支付中,区块链可以减少中介机构的参与,降低交易费用和时间。此外,它还能够提供实时的交易透明性,让所有参与者都能查看交易的全过程,提升了交易的安全性和信任度。对于小微企业而言,区块链还可以通过更便捷的融资渠道,降低融资难度,提高资金流动性。
为了保证智能合约的安全性,编写合约时应遵循安全编码的最佳实践,包括代码重用、合理的权限管理、防止重放攻击等。此外,应进行全面的安全审计,有条件的情况下,可以选择经过验证的智能合约模板来避免重复发送已经被审计的合约代码。通过持续的监测与维护,及时修复已识别的漏洞,也是保障智能合约安全的重要方式。
区块链金融服务的未来趋势将更加注重综合性与创新性。随着技术的发展,金融机构将积极探索结合区块链与人工智能、大数据等技术的新模式,推动金融服务的智能化。此外,区块链技术将在合规、风险管理和客户服务中发挥更重要的作用。此外,随着监管政策的不断成熟,区块链技术有望更深入地融入金融行业,带动整个行业的转型与升级。
综上所述,尽管区块链金融机构在安全性方面面临多重挑战,但通过有效的策略和措施,可以在保障安全的前提下,更好地利用区块链技术促进金融业务的发展。
leave a reply